What You Need to Know About Local Concrete Regulations?
Comprehending local concrete regulations is essential for any building undertaking, as these rules govern various aspects of concrete usage, including composition standards, placement procedures, and environmental considerations. These regulations are typically established by local or regional authorities and can vary greatly from one location to another.
Contractors should comprehend zoning laws, which can govern where concrete structures may be erected. Additionally, building codes typically specify the required strength and composition of concrete mixes, promoting safety and durability. Environmental regulations may also mandate the use of eco-friendly materials and proper waste disposal methods to minimize environmental impact.
Noncompliance with these regulations can trigger assessments, project postponements, or even lawsuits. In turn, liaising with local authorities in the initial phases of the planning process is wise. Understanding and complying with these regulations not only promotes community safety but also strengthens the integrity of the construction project.

The Significance of Quality Materials and Approaches in Concrete Work
Excellence in concrete work is essential, as it directly determines the durability and longevity of any construction project. The selection of high-grade materials plays a key role; inferior concrete can lead to cracking, erosion, and structural failure over time. Using quality aggregates, cement, and additives assures that the final product can withstand environmental stresses and heavy loads.
Moreover, leveraging state-of-the-art methods during the mixing, pouring, and curing processes markedly enhances the solidity of the concrete. Proper proportional combinations and curing methods facilitate achieving ideal robustness and diminish vulnerabilities. Experienced contractors grasp these particulars and deploy optimal procedures to secure excellent performance.
Ultimately, putting money into high-quality materials and methods not only improves the structural performance but also minimizes long-term maintenance costs. This basis of dependability is essential for both residential and commercial projects, assuring that they endure through the years. Quality in concrete work is an investment that pays dividends.

How much duration will a standard concrete assignment normally take?
A typical concrete project usually takes between one to three days, based on factors such as project size, complexity, weather conditions, and curing time. Bigger or more complex projects may need additional time for completion.
What Are the Ordinary Evidence of Faulty Concrete Work?
Common signs of deficient concrete work consist of visible cracks, uneven surfaces, faulty water flow, discoloration, flaking, and surface dusting. These issues typically point to incomplete setting, improper mixing, or insufficient preparation, compromising the structure's integrity and lifespan.

How Can Weather Conditions Influence Concrete Curing Processes?
Weather conditions greatly affect concrete hardening. High temperatures can speed up drying, causing cracking, while cold can slow the process, risking incomplete hydration. Ideal curing demands moderate temperatures and regulated moisture to guarantee durability and strength.
